


Paddington Ice Cream Parlour is a beloved local spot in Melbourne's inner suburbs, serving up handmade ice cream with rotating seasonal flavors that keep families coming back year-round. The welcoming, family-friendly atmosphere and quality treats make it a perfect reward stop after exploring nearby parks or as a sweet destination in itself.
Weekday afternoons (2-4pm) are ideal for shorter queues. Summer months (December to February) are peak season, but the parlour shines year-round. Avoid Saturday afternoons when local families flock here after weekend activities.
Prices are budget-friendly (under $10 AUD per person typically). Limited seating inside, so be prepared to enjoy your treats while strolling the charming Paddington streets. The shop is wheelchair accessible with a street-level entrance.
Open year-round, though summer (December to February) sees the biggest crowds. Winter visits (June to August) offer a cozy treat with minimal wait times. Check for special flavors during Australian holidays like Australia Day (January 26).
Paddington offers several family-friendly cafes and bakeries within walking distance for a light meal before or after your ice cream treat. The nearby shopping strip has pizza shops and casual eateries with outdoor seating.
